Understanding DailyPay: More Than Just a "Payday Loan"
It's crucial to distinguish DailyPay from traditional payday loans. A payday loan is a high-interest, short-term debt that can trap individuals in a cycle of borrowing. DailyPay, conversely, is not a loan. It's simply providing access to wages an employee has already earned but hasn't yet been paid due to payroll cycles.
Think of it like this: an employee works a shift on Monday. By Tuesday morning, those wages are technically "earned." DailyPay allows them to access a portion (or up to 100% in some cases) of those earned wages instantly, rather than waiting until the scheduled payday. This model promotes financial responsibility and provides genuine relief without incurring debt.

The Flow of Data: What DailyPay Needs to See
For DailyPay to function effectively, it acts as a secure intermediary, reading essential data from your payroll system. This real-time synchronization ensures that when an employee requests funds, DailyPay knows precisely how much they’ve earned.
Based on integrations with systems like Empeon and ADP Workforce Now® Next Generation, DailyPay typically reads the following categories of information:
- Core Employee Information: This includes names, contact details (phones, emails), and unique employee identifiers (Worker ID, File Number, Position ID). This ensures DailyPay can correctly identify and communicate with each employee.
- Work Assignment & Remuneration Details: DailyPay needs to understand work assignments, job codes, base rates, and pay history to accurately calculate earned wages. This involves details like job titles, department, and salary or hourly rates.
- Organizational & Pay Cycle Data: Information on your company’s organizational structure, location, pay cycle codes, and payroll group codes helps DailyPay align with your existing operational rhythms.
- Hire & Assignment Status: Knowing an employee's hire/rehire date and current assignment status ensures eligibility and accurate calculations for their tenure.
- Payday Data: Crucial for reconciliation, this includes the scheduled paydate, pay period end date, and the total payment amount from your payroll system.
- Time Card Data: To determine earned wages, DailyPay reads time-and-attendance information, such as shift dates, pay codes, and duration of shifts. This is the foundation for calculating an employee's available balance.
- Sensitive Personal Information (Optional but often Beneficial): In some integrations, DailyPay may view sensitive data like Social Security Numbers (SSN), Dates of Birth (DOB), and full direct deposit account numbers. This data is critical for identity verification, compliance, and, in some cases, for managing direct deposit accounts directly within the DailyPay system. The Feedback Loop: What DailyPay Sends Back to Payroll
The integration isn't a one-way street. To ensure your payroll remains accurate and seamless, DailyPay also sends data back to your system. This bi-directional exchange ensures that any funds accessed by employees through DailyPay are properly accounted for on their next scheduled payday.
From the ADP Workforce Now® Next Generation example, DailyPay typically sends information such as:
- Pay Distributions: Details on how an employee's pay should be distributed, reflecting any amounts already accessed.
- Account and Routing Numbers: If an employee has updated their direct deposit information via DailyPay, these details are sent back to your payroll system.
- Deduction Code & Effective Date: This helps categorize the accessed wages within your payroll system, along with the date the adjustment takes effect.
- Status: Updates on the transaction status for reconciliation.
This comprehensive data flow means that despite employees accessing wages early, your payroll team doesn't have to manually adjust records or worry about disruptions. Real-World Integration Examples: Empeon and ADP
The integration process is designed to be as straightforward as possible, often leveraging existing payroll functionalities.
- DailyPay and Empeon: For businesses using Empeon's payroll system, integration is initiated by submitting a "Marketplace Integration Request Form" to Customer Support. This formally requests the connection, granting DailyPay the necessary permissions to:
- View employee details (pay, base rate, history, punches).
- View sensitive PII (SSN, DOB, direct deposit account).
- Manage (add, view, update, delete) direct deposit account information.
This level of access ensures real-time synchronization and accurate wage calculations. - DailyPay Connector for ADP Workforce Now® Next Generation: ADP clients benefit from a dedicated "Data Connector" which facilitates a real-time, bi-directional data exchange. This robust connection allows for easy activation of DailyPay and enables employees to access up to 100% of their earned wages prior to payday. The integration means ADP clients can offer DailyPay with minimal administrative burden, leveraging their existing payroll infrastructure. Employees can then manage their transfers instantly via the DailyPay iOS or Android apps.
In both cases, the core principle remains: no disruption to your current payroll process or the timing of payroll funds. DailyPay operates in the background, making funds available while your established payroll cycles continue uninterrupted.
Who's Eligible? Employee & Employer Criteria for DailyPay
While the integration is technically sophisticated, the eligibility criteria are generally straightforward for both businesses and their employees.
For Employers: Stepping Up to Offer DailyPay
If you're considering offering DailyPay, your primary eligibility requirements revolve around your operational setup and commitment to employee financial wellness:
- Compatible Payroll and Time & Attendance System: This is the most critical factor. DailyPay needs to integrate with your existing systems (like Empeon, ADP Workforce Now® Next Generation, or other major providers) to accurately track earned wages and manage fund transfers. If your system isn't directly supported, DailyPay can often work with you to find a solution.
- Willingness to Integrate: You'll need to be prepared for the technical integration process, which typically involves collaboration between your IT/payroll team and DailyPay's implementation specialists. This might include submitting integration request forms (as with Empeon) or activating specific data connectors (as with ADP).
- Commitment to Employee Financial Wellness: Ultimately, offering DailyPay reflects a strategic decision to invest in your employees' financial health and overall well-being.
There isn't typically a hard-and-fast rule about minimum employee counts for DailyPay, but larger organizations with established payroll systems often find the integration most seamless.
For Employees: Accessing Your Earned Wages
Once your company has integrated with DailyPay, the eligibility for your individual employees is quite simple:
- Employment with a DailyPay Partner: The primary requirement is that their employer (you!) has partnered with and integrated DailyPay.
- Active Employee Status: Employees must be actively employed and in good standing with the company.
- Paid via Direct Deposit: DailyPay transactions are typically handled through direct deposit, so employees usually need to have a direct deposit account set up.
- Accumulated Earned Wages: An employee must have actually worked hours or days for which they have not yet been paid. DailyPay’s access is based on these accumulated, but unpaid, earned wages.
The Integration Journey: A Step-by-Step Overview for Employers
Bringing DailyPay to your workforce is a structured process, designed to ensure a smooth transition and successful rollout.
Step 1: Initial Interest & Consultation
Your journey begins with an initial conversation with DailyPay. This is where you discuss your organization's needs, understand the full scope of the DailyPay offering, and get a clearer picture of how it aligns with your company culture and financial goals. DailyPay's team will assess your current payroll environment and provide a tailored proposal.
Step 2: Payroll System Compatibility & Data Mapping
Once you decide to move forward, DailyPay's integration specialists will work closely with your payroll and IT teams. This phase involves:
- System Review: Verifying the compatibility of your existing payroll and time-and-attendance systems (e.g., Empeon, ADP Workforce Now® Next Generation).
- Data Mapping: Identifying and mapping the specific data fields that DailyPay needs to read from your system and what data it will send back. This is where the details like employee names, pay rates, time card data, and sensitive PII are precisely defined for secure exchange.
- Permissions & Access: For systems like Empeon, this might involve submitting the "Marketplace Integration Request Form" to grant the necessary viewing and management permissions. For ADP, activating the "Data Connector" takes center stage.
Step 3: Security Protocols & Testing
Data security is paramount. During this phase, robust security protocols are established and tested. This includes:
- Secure Connection: Establishing encrypted connections for data transfer.
- Compliance Checks: Ensuring that the integration adheres to all relevant data privacy regulations (e.g., SOC 2, GDPR, CCPA).
- Pilot Program (Optional): Some organizations choose to run a pilot program with a small group of employees to iron out any kinks and gather initial feedback before a full rollout.
Step 4: Activation & Employee Onboarding
With the technical integration complete and thoroughly tested, it’s time to launch DailyPay to your entire workforce.
- Employee Communication: Clear and comprehensive communication to employees about the new benefit, how it works, and how to enroll. DailyPay provides resources and templates to help with this.
- Enrollment: Employees download the DailyPay mobile app (available on iOS and Android) and follow simple steps to enroll, linking their bank account and providing necessary consent.
- Ongoing Support: DailyPay offers dedicated support for both employers and employees, ensuring a smooth ongoing experience.

Payroll Integrity: No Disruptions, Just Enhancements
One of the most significant advantages of DailyPay's integration model is its commitment to maintaining the integrity of your existing payroll processes.
- Operates Alongside, Not Within: DailyPay doesn't replace your payroll system. It sits alongside it, drawing necessary data and sending back summarized information for reconciliation.
- Automated Reconciliation: The bi-directional data flow ensures that any early wage access is automatically deducted from an employee’s next paycheck, eliminating manual adjustments for your payroll team.
- Consistent Payday: Your official payday remains unchanged. Funds accessed early are simply a draw against earned wages, not a change to the fundamental payroll cycle or your funding obligations.
This design means your payroll team can continue their work exactly as before, freeing them from the administrative burden that might come with other early wage access solutions.
